npm初始化失败安解决方法(2024)运行npm出现禁止运行脚本

先更改执行策略,再执行安装命令即可。

1,打开cmd,输入 powershell

2,打开powershell后,再输入 Start-Process  powershell -verb runAs   意为以管理员权限运行powershell

3.以管理员权限运行powershell后,输入   set-executionpolicy remotesigned

如果第一次输入敲下回车后没有任何输入,只是换行的话,像我这样

那么再输入再回车,直至更改执行策略出来

然后选择y,大小写都可。

最后输入  get-executionpolicy  即再去  打开新的终端输入

npm install -g babel-cli  命令重新安装babel

第二种解决方案,我就是这样弄好的,先运行  npm install -g babel-cli  后,后面执行babel --version的时候,发现报错接下来我更改了执行策略后,发现就可以运行了。相当于我的步骤是倒过来的。

### npm 初始化项目的具体方法及配置流程 #### 1. 确认环境准备 在开始初始化项目之前,需要确保已经正确装了 Node.jsnpm。可以通过以下命令验证其版本号: ```bash node -v npm -v ``` 如果返回对应的版本号,则表明环境已准备好[^2]。 #### 2. 使用 `npm init` 创建项目 执行以下命令来初始化一个新的 npm 项目: ```bash npm init ``` 该命令会引导用户逐步输入项目的基本信息,例如名称、版本、描述、入口文件路径等。这些信息会被写入到 `package.json` 文件中,作为项目的配置中心。 对于希望快速完成初始化而不逐一填写字段的情况,可以使用 `-y` 参数(即自动接受所有默认设置): ```bash npm init -y ``` 这将在当前目录下生成一个带有默认值的 `package.json` 文件[^1]。 #### 3. 配置 `package.json` `package.json` 是 npm 的核心配置文件,包含了关于项目的元数据和依赖项等内容。以下是常见的字段及其作用: - **name**: 项目名称。 - **version**: 当前版本号。 - **description**: 对项目的简单描述。 - **main**: 主入口文件,默认为 `index.js`。 - **scripts**: 定义脚本命令,比如构建工具或测试框架的相关指令。 - **dependencies**: 生产环境中所需的第三方库列表。 - **devDependencies**: 开发阶段使用的额外依赖,如编译器或调试工具。 手动编辑此文件时需要注意保持 JSON 格式的合法性;不过通常推荐利用交互式向导或者自动化参数来自动生成它。 #### 4. 添加 Vue 支持(可选) 假如目标是一个基于 Vue 技术栈的应用程序开发场景,那么还需要引入必要的组件支持。例如全局装 Vue 模板解析器以便处理 `.vue` 文件扩展名下的单文件组件结构: ```bash npm install vue-template-compiler -g ``` 之后便能正常运行服务端监听并预览本地实例化成果: ```bash npm run serve ``` 上述操作适用于那些遵循官方模板定义好的工程布局样式[^3]。 --- #### 总结 综上所述,借助于强大的 npm 工具集能够轻松实现从零搭建前端应用的基础骨架工作流——只需几步简单的终端指令配合恰当的选择调整就能获得一份标准化程度较高的初始代码仓库雏形!
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值